Blyton Cum Laughton Church of England School is a primary school in Gainsborough for ages 4 to 11. It is one of the 393 schools in Lincolnshire. It ranks 8th of 16 primary schools in Gainsborough. Its latest Ofsted rating is Good, from an inspection in November 2023.
